PERFORMANCE OF GROWING COTURNIX QUAILS (COTURNIX COTURNIX JAPONICA) FED DIFFERENT WATER SOURCES.

A study of 6 weeks was conducted to determine the effect of different water sources on the performance of growing Japanese quails. A total of two hundred 2-week old quail birds of mixed sexes were randomly allocated to four water treatments in a completely randomized design. The birds were allocated fifty per replicate. Every replicate has 15 birds with the extra birds distributed without bias at a bird per replicate. Feed given was an on-farm quail chick mash with feed and water supplied ad libitum for 6 weeks. The water sources were from borehole (control), well, stream and dam respectively. Birds on treatment A consumed the highest feed (17.42g), followed by those on treatment C (17.13), D (15.17) and B (15.16). However, the differences were not significant (p˃0.05). Water intake of birds on treatment A was higher (39.97ml/bird) than those on treatment C (35.84), B (33.32) and D (32.86) respectively. However, differences were not significant (p ˃0.05). Birds on treatment D had a higher weight gain (3.88g/bird), followed by those on treatment C (3.67), B (3.62) and A (3.29) in that order. The differences were not also significant (p˃0.05). Feed conversion ratio of birds seemed to follow a similar trend with water intake. It was better on treatment D (3.98) followed by those on B (4.14), C (4.76) and A (5.36) respectively. Result of this investigation showed that birds can be raised on any of the water sources. However, water from borehole and well have better control than those from other sources.
